Dante N. Ferno is back and he’s trekking off to summer camp with high hopes of making a splash in this second book in the outrageously funny, heavily illustrated middle-grade trilogy published in partnership with Macmillan UK—perfect for fans of Diary of a Wimpy Kid.
Summer is here, and two-horned demon Dante Nimrod Ferno is spending the break at Camp Sulfur Springs with his angelic best friend Virgil. But as his plans to make friends and influence his fellow campers go wildly awry, and a counselor everyone else admires keeps getting under his skin, can Dante prevent his time at camp from turning into a total catastrophe?
The second book in Brian Gordon's Dante N. Ferno trilogy, Camp Catastrophe is filled with loads of laugh-out-loud humor and black-and-white illustrations in every chapter.
